Abstract

Aqueous formulations of indacaterol are disclosed. The formulations may find use in the treatment of respiratory disorders, inflammatory disorders, or obstructive airway diseases. Methods of using the formulations and kits comprising the formulations are also encompassed by the disclosure.

Claims (30)

1 - 20 . (canceled)

21 . An aqueous pharmaceutical composition comprising:

from about 20 weight percent to 99.9 weight percent water;

indacaterol, or a pharmaceutically acceptable salt thereof, present at a concentration of 10 μg/mL to 2 mg/mL;

glycopyrrolate, or a pharmaceutically acceptable salt thereof, present at a concentration of about 10 μg/mL to 2 mg/mL,

two or more tonicity modifiers; and

a buffer,

wherein the indacaterol is present as a free base or as a pharmaceutically acceptable salt thereof without the presence of maleic acid from a maleate salt in the aqueous pharmaceutical composition, and

wherein the aqueous pharmaceutical composition has a pH from 3 to 5.

22 . The pharmaceutical composition of claim 21 , wherein the indacaterol, or a pharmaceutically acceptable salt thereof, is present at a concentration of 10 μg/mL to 200 μg/mL.

23 . The pharmaceutical composition of claim 21 , wherein one of the two or more tonicity modifiers is present at a concentration of about 100 mM to about 500 mM.

24 . The pharmaceutical composition of claim 21 , wherein one or the two tonicity modifiers is sodium chloride.

25 . The pharmaceutical composition of claim 21 , wherein the buffer comprises an anion selected from the group consisting of acetate, bromide, chloride, citrate, furoate, fumarate, propionate, succinate, sulfate, tartrate, and xinafoate.

26 . The pharmaceutical composition of claim 25 , wherein the anion of the buffer in the aqueous pharmaceutical composition is citrate.

27 . The pharmaceutical composition of claim 21 , wherein the buffer in the aqueous pharmaceutical composition is prepared from a combination of citric acid and sodium hydroxide.

28 . The pharmaceutical composition of claim 21 , wherein the buffer in the aqueous pharmaceutical composition is prepared from a combination of citric acid and trisodium citrate.

29 . The pharmaceutical composition of claim 25 , wherein the anion of the buffer in the aqueous pharmaceutical composition is acetate.

30 . The pharmaceutical composition of claim 21 , wherein the buffer in the aqueous pharmaceutical composition is prepared from a combination of acetic acid and sodium hydroxide.

31 . The pharmaceutical composition of claim 21 , wherein the buffer in the aqueous pharmaceutical composition is prepared from a combination of acetic acid and sodium acetate.

32 . The pharmaceutical composition of claim 25 , wherein the anion of the buffer in the aqueous pharmaceutical composition is tartrate.

33 . The pharmaceutical composition of claim 21 , wherein the aqueous pharmaceutical composition has a pH from 3.5. to 4.5.

34 . The pharmaceutical composition of claim 21 , wherein the glycopyrrolate, or a pharmaceutically acceptable salt thereof, is glycopyrronium bromide.

35 . The pharmaceutical composition of claim 21 , wherein the glycopyrrolate, or a pharmaceutically acceptable salt thereof, is present in the aqueous pharmaceutical composition at a concentration in a range from about 50 μg/mL to about 200 μg/mL.

36 . The pharmaceutical composition of claim 21 , wherein the concentration of the indacaterol in the aqueous pharmaceutical composition is between about 50 μg/mL to about 200 μg/mL; and the concentration of the glycopyrrolate, or a pharmaceutically acceptable salt thereof, in the aqueous pharmaceutical composition is between about 50 μg/mL to about 200 μg/mL.

37 . The pharmaceutical composition of claim 21 , further comprising an inhaled corticosteroid.

38 . The pharmaceutical composition of claim 21 , wherein the aqueous pharmaceutical composition does not comprise ethanol or a cyclodextrin.

39 . A kit comprising

the pharmaceutical composition of claim 21 ; and

a device for aerosolizing the pharmaceutical composition.

40 . The kit of claim 39 , wherein the device is selected from the group consisting of a jet nebulizer and a vibrating mesh nebulizer.
